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Choosing A Small 50-Watt Or Low-Watt Heater
- Power and intended space: In very small spaces, 50W units can provide gentle warmth, but larger desks or bedrooms may benefit from higher wattage options. Consider whether you want spot heating or broader room coverage.
- Energy efficiency: Look for models with steady-state output and precise thermostats. Features like ECO modes, 1°F or 1°C increments, and auto-shutoff when the target temperature is reached help save energy over time.
- Safety features: Essential protections include tip-over switches, overheat protection, flame-retardant housing, and cool-touch exteriors. Certifications from recognized bodies add an extra layer of assurance.
- Control options: Remote controls, digital displays, and programmable timers offer convenience, especially for office or bedside use. Some models support oscillation or multi-speed fans to improve heat distribution.
- Portability and design: Compact form factors with integrated handles simplify relocation between rooms. Quiet operation is a common priority for bedrooms and study areas.
- Durability and materials: Heaters built with ceramic cores and robust casings tend to last longer and resist damage in high-traffic spaces.
- Maintenance and cleaning: Choose units with easy-to-clean grilles or removable filters if applicable. Regular checks help maintain performance and safety.
- Warranty and support: A longer warranty reduces risk, especially for budget-friendly options. Review return policies and customer support accessibility.
When selecting a heater, align wattage with the space you intend to heat, and balance safety features with desired controls and energy efficiency.
